Wing locker tanks, each with 20 gallons total capacity, became options with the 1967 models. Cruise speeds remained around 182 KIAS, while the maximum structural speed was gently bumped from 215 KIAS to 223 KIAS in late models. Other recent and notable ADs include: 98-1-8, replacement of two-piece carb venturis with one-piece units; 97-26-17, ultrasonic inspection of the crankshafts with possible replacement; 96-12-22, repetitive inspections of the engine oil filter adapters; and 96-20-7, repetitive inspection of the combustion tubes on the Janitrol cabin heater. Together, this means that 310s came with total capacities of 100, 140, 163, 183, or 203 gallons. Early 310s could manage 415 feet per minute on one engine at maximum gross weight (4,700 pounds in the 310B). Theres no separate gauge for each tank, though the gauge does switch automatically to read the tank being used (but not the wing locker tanks, which have no fuel level senders). The bigger Continental came aboard in the 1975 model, the R. It's interesting to note that through the life of the 310, engine power was increased only 45 hp a side. According to Larry Balls The Twin Cessna Flyer, nearly half of all twin Cessna accidents and incidents are directly related to the gear, and a quarter of all accidents and incidents are related to failure of the nose gear idler bellcrank under the pilots feet. New bladders cost between $800 and $1,000 apiece; refurbishing costs one-quarter to half as much as new. The weight of the fuel concentrated on the tip tanks adds a significant roll tendency, which can be exacerbated into pilot-induced oscillations if one does not take it easy on the ailerons.
